Cuisine of Lansdowne

There is Variety of local delicacies which local dishes such as Kafuli, Phaanu, Thechwani, Baadi, Kulath ki dal and Aloo ke gutke. Besides, you can also enjoy some sweet dishes like Gulgula and Arsa and Chinese and Continental dishes. The Garhwali cuisine is simple, nutritious and delicious. Veggies are consumed on a large scale here, although there are a lot of non-veg eaters too. Besides Garhwali food, one can also find other cuisines like Mughlai, Marwari as well as Continental.

Tarkeshwar Mahadev Temple

Tarkeshwar Mahadev Temple, located nearby Lansdowne and situates atop of a hill of height 2092 meters, is believed to be one of the ancient holy sites or SiddhaPitas. The main deity is Lord Shiva and many devotees visit this ancient temple to offer prayers and it is believed that the offerings here makes the wishes of the devotees be fulfilled. Mahashivarathri is celebrated annually with grandeur. The temple place is surrounded by thick blue pine forests, oak trees and dense Deodars. The spectacular feature of this place is that even at this high altitude, there are many water pools that flowing continuously.

Garhwali Mess

Garhwali Mess is one of the oldest buildings in the hill station, which was built by the British in January 1988. The mess reflects the rich heritage of the Army and also of the destination in general. It is one of the old and finely preserved heritage buildings of Lansdowne.

The mess is considered to be an important museum in Asia, comprising atypical compilation of skin of wild animals, furnishings and trophies. There is a dial consisting of arrow symbols that direct the route for Nandadevi, Chaukhamba, Kamet and other snow-capped peaks of the Himalayan Range.

Bhim Pakora

Bhim Pakora is located in Dhura, about 2 km away from the Gandhi Chowk. It is believed that during the period of exile, the Pandavas stopped here and cooked food at this location. It is also believed that Bhim placed one rock on top of the other and is so well balanced that it never topples. This rock can be moved by tourists with just one finger, but it never falls down.

The Garhwal Rifles Regimental War Memorial

The Garhwal Rifles Regimental War Memorial at Lansdowne was established on 11th November 1923. Lord Rawlinson of Trent, the then Commander in Chief of India, founded this museum. A major tourist attraction of the destination, this war memorial is located at the Parade Ground. It is one of the few tourist attractions that are visited by almost every traveler coming to Lansdowne. Tourists who are interested in knowing about the Indian army also throng this place.

Bhulla Tal

Bhulla Tal is an artificial lake dedicated to the young Garhwali youth of Garhwal Rifles, who rendered help for construction of this lake. This tourist attraction gets its name from the Garhwali word, Bhulla which means younger brother. Here the tourists can also enjoy boating and paddling. A children park, bamboo machan and fountains have been erected here for entertainment of tourists.

How to reach Lansdowne village

By Air: Jolly Grant Airport is the nearest Airport to Lansdowne situated at a distance of 148kms. Jolly Grant Airport is well connected to Delhi with daily flights. Lansdowne is well connected by motorable roads with Jolly Grant Airport. Taxis are available from Jolly Grant Airport to Lansdowne.

By Rail: The nearest railhead to Lansdowne is Kotdwar situated at a distance 40 kms. Kotdwar is well connected by railway networks with major cities of India. There are regular trains running to Lansdowne from major destinations of north India. Taxis and buses are easily available from Kotdwar to Lansdowne.

By Road: Lansdowne is well connected by motorable roads with major destinations of Uttarakhand state. Buses to Kotdwar and Dugadda are easily available from ISBT Kashmiri Gate. Buses and Taxis to Lansdowne are available from Kotdwar, Dugadda, Pauri and other major destinations of Uttarakhand state. Lansdowne is connected with National highway 119.

Haridwar (Approx 110.0km. / 2-3 hours from Lansdowne)

Haridwar is also spelled as Hardwar or Hari-ka - Dwar. Haridwar meaning Gateway to God is one of the seven holiest places of the Hindus, located on the banks of River Ganges. It is the place where river Ganga descends to the plains. Haridwar is often mentioned in ancient scriptures and even referred during the British times. With Ujjain, Nasik and Allahabad, Haridwar forms the four important pilgrimage centers of India where Kumbh Mela is celebrated here after every 3 years rotated over these 4 destinations.

New Tehri (Approx 200.0 km. / 6 hours from Lansdowne)

New Tehri is the only planned hill township of Uttarakhand which was made during the construction of the Tehri dam. Every month thousands of tourists visit Tehri to see the stagnant water of the massive Tehri Dam. The Dam is situated amidst high mountains many of which are submerged under water. New Tehri is very well connected with motorable roads. Tehri is situated 69 kms from Mussoorie. There are many good hotels in New Tehri.

Budher Caves

At a distance of about 30 km from Chakrata, lies the Budher caves, also known as Miola caves. The name Miola is after the German person who discovered this cave and this cave is now a popular spot for spelunking or exploring caves.

The cave is believed to be dug by Pandavas during their "Vanvaas" or exile before the Mahabharata War was fought. The cave is around 150m long and is a brilliant spot for adrenalin junkies who are looking for some caving opportunities. The caves are mostly formed out of limestone rocks with brilliant stalagmite and stalactite formations
